How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• ruling that \indefinite intention\ test, as applied to college students, violated the Federal Equal Protection Clause on the ground that the requirement that a voter intend to stay in New Hampshire indefinitely is not necessary to serve a compelling interest
  • explaining that for purposes of establishing a domicile, a person need not “say that he will always—or indefinitely—live in a particular town”
